    TL;DR: Google DeepMind’s Genie 3 is an AI world model that generates interactive, dynamic virtual environments from text prompts in real-time. For startups, this technology represents a massive opportunity to accelerate product development, create immersive experiences, and lower the barriers to entry for building virtual worlds, from rapid prototyping and AI agent training to revolutionizing creative media.


    The AI Advantage: How Genie 3 Can Accelerate Your Startup’s Innovation Cycle

    The world of generative AI is moving at a breakneck pace, and Google DeepMind has just shifted the goalposts with the release of Genie 3. This isn’t just another video generation tool; it’s a foundation world model capable of creating fully interactive, dynamic environments from a simple text prompt. For startups, this technology isn’t just a curiosity—it’s a potential game-changer that can revolutionize how you build, test, and deliver products.

    In this article, we’ll dive deep into what makes Genie 3 a pivotal moment in AI and explore how ambitious startups can leverage its unique capabilities to gain a significant competitive edge.

    What Exactly is Genie 3?

    Before we explore the opportunities, let’s understand the core technology. Previous generative AI models like Veo and Sora were brilliant at creating stunning, realistic videos. Genie 3 takes this concept several steps further. Instead of generating a passive video clip, it creates a fully responsive, 720p virtual world that you can navigate and interact with in real-time AI.

    Imagine typing “a futuristic city with flying cars” and instantly being able to walk through that city, exploring streets, and observing the environment as it reacts to your movements. This is the power of Genie 3. The model maintains consistency and memory of the environment over several minutes, which is a significant leap forward in video generation technology. It’s the first world model to offer this level of real-time control, making it an invaluable tool for anyone looking to build interactive AI environments from text prompts.

    Why Should Startups Pay Attention?

    For a startup, resources are everything. The traditional process of building virtual environments for games, simulations, or educational tools is incredibly resource-intensive, requiring specialized teams of 3D artists, animators, and game developers. Genie 3 dramatically lowers this barrier to entry. Here’s how you can leverage its features to your advantage:

    1. Rapid Prototyping and Simulation: The ability to generate entire worlds on the fly is a superpower for product development. Instead of spending weeks or months creating a single simulation environment, you can use Genie 3 to:

    • Test AI Agents: If your startup is developing AI-driven robots or autonomous systems, you can drop your agents into an unlimited number of virtual worlds to test their skills and train them on an infinite curriculum of challenges and edge cases.
    • Run “What-If” Scenarios: A logistics startup could generate a city to simulate traffic flow under different conditions. An architectural firm could quickly visualize a new building design in various urban or natural settings. This capability allows you to test ideas and gather data without a massive investment in a custom-built simulation engine.

    2. Creating Immersive and Unique User Experiences: Genie 3’s capabilities extend far beyond gaming. Startups in sectors like education, marketing, and creative media can use it to build compelling new products.

    • Educational Platforms: Imagine a history startup allowing students to walk through a generated recreation of ancient Rome. A biology ed-tech company could let students explore a vibrant, real-time ecosystem of their own design.
    • Interactive Marketing: A brand could create a dynamic, personalized marketing experience where users can navigate a world built around their product. This level of engagement is unprecedented and can create powerful, lasting connections with customers.

    3. The Future of Content Creation: The ability to generate complex, dynamic worlds from a simple description is poised to disrupt the creative industry. Startups in animation and filmmaking can use Genie 3 to create intricate scenes and fantastical scenarios without needing a giant production team or a 3D engine. The model’s capacity to handle everything from rugged volcanic landscapes to surreal, animated creatures opens up new frontiers for visual storytelling.

    Genie 3’s Limitations and The Road Ahead

    While Genie 3 is a monumental step forward, it’s not a silver bullet. The technology is still in its early stages and has known limitations. The search results from our research note that it currently struggles with:

    • Social and multi-agent interactions.
    • Long-instruction following (e.g., complex game logic like “collect 5 keys to open a door”).
    • A limited action space for user controls.

    These limitations are important to consider, but they don’t diminish its value. The current version of Genie 3 is a powerful tool for world generation and simulation, providing a clear glimpse into the future where building interactive experiences is as simple as writing a text prompt.

  • GitHub Spark: Your New AI Co-Pilot for Tailored Micro Apps

    GitHub Spark: Your New AI Co-Pilot for Tailored Micro Apps

    In the rapidly evolving landscape of software development, the demand for personalized experiences and rapid prototyping is at an all-time high. Enter GitHub Spark, an innovative AI-powered tool that’s set to transform how we approach software personalization and micro-app creation. Designed to make software customization as intuitive as tweaking your development environment, GitHub Spark empowers everyone, regardless of coding expertise, to build tailored software solutions.

    Currently, GitHub Spark is in public beta and exclusively available to GitHub Copilot+ users. This early access allows a select group of innovators to experience the future of personalized software development firsthand, shaping its evolution with their feedback.

    The Vision: Software Personalization for Everyone

    Historically, creating custom applications meant navigating complex coding languages, intricate frameworks, and tedious deployment processes. This often placed bespoke software solutions out of reach for many, especially early-stage founders needing to iterate quickly or non-technical users looking for highly specific tools. GitHub Spark shatters these barriers. It’s a testament to the idea that powerful software should be accessible and adaptable to individual needs, without the heavy lifting of traditional development.

    What is GitHub Spark? Your AI-Powered Micro-App Factory

    At its core, GitHub Spark is an AI-powered tool for creating and sharing “sparks” – personalized micro apps. Imagine having an

    AI-powered development assistant that understands your ideas and translates them into functional software you can use on your desktop or mobile device. That’s precisely what GitHub Spark offers. It requires virtually zero knowledge in traditional software development; you don’t need to worry about user authentication, managing databases, or deploying complex infrastructure – Spark handles all these intricate details behind the scenes.

    The brilliance of Spark lies in its simplicity and advanced underlying technology:

    • Natural Language (NL) Based Editor: Forget writing lines of code. With Spark, you describe your ideas using natural language, and the tool intelligently interprets your intentions to construct the micro app. This makes no-code development a reality for complex, personalized solutions.
    • Managed Runtime Environment: Spark provides a seamless, managed runtime environment that hosts your “sparks”. This environment handles all the backend complexities, offering access to data storage, theming options, and even powerful Large Language Models (LLMs). This means you don’t need to worry about server setup, database management, or integrating AI models – Spark handles it all.
    • PWA-Enabled Dashboard: Managing and launching your personalized micro apps is intuitive through a Progressive Web App (PWA) enabled dashboard. This ensures your custom applications are always accessible and performant across various devices.
    • Version Control & Collaboration: One of Spark’s powerful features is its tight integration with GitHub. This not only ensures seamless sharing but also allows you to quickly navigate between different versions of your micro app. This robust version control means you can experiment, revert changes, and track your progress with ease, providing a safety net for rapid iteration and creative exploration.

    Understanding Micro Apps and Their Impact

    You might be wondering, what exactly is a micro app, and why is it so beneficial?

    A micro app is a small, single-purpose application designed to perform a very specific function or solve a particular problem. Unlike monolithic applications that try to do everything, micro apps are lean, focused, and designed for efficiency. Think of them as specialized tools in a larger toolbox. Examples could range from a simple internal calculator tailored for a specific business metric, a dashboard that pulls data from disparate sources, a personalized notification system, or a quick-entry form for a specific workflow.

    For startups and companies, the benefits of leveraging micro apps through GitHub Spark are immense:

    • Rapid Prototyping and Validation: Startups can quickly build and test specific features or workflows with real users without developing a full-blown product. This accelerates the validation process, saving time and resources.
    • Increased Agility: Companies can respond to new business needs or market shifts with unprecedented speed. A specific operational bottleneck? A micro app can be spun up in hours to address it.
    • Reduced Development Costs: By eliminating the need for extensive coding, database management, and deployment expertise, organizations can significantly reduce the costs associated with custom software development.
    • Empowering Non-Technical Teams: Business analysts, product managers, and even sales teams can create their own tailored tools, automating tasks and gaining insights without relying solely on IT or development departments. This fosters innovation from within every part of the organization.
    • Enhanced Productivity: By automating small, repetitive tasks or providing highly specialized tools, micro apps can streamline workflows and boost individual and team productivity.

    Beyond Creation: Sharing and Collaboration

    GitHub Spark isn’t just about personal creation; it’s also about collaboration and community. Users can easily share their “sparks” with others, controlling permissions to ensure privacy and security. This feature opens up a world of possibilities for teams to rapidly distribute internal tools, or for individuals to share their innovative

    custom applications with a broader audience. The ability for others to favorite or remix sparks further fosters a collaborative ecosystem, enabling rapid iteration and shared innovation.

  • Gemini CLI vs. GitHub Copilot CLI vs. Claude Code CLI

    The command line interface (CLI) has long been the heart of developer workflows, offering speed and efficiency that GUIs often can’t match. Now, with the rapid advancements in AI, our terminals are becoming even smarter, thanks to powerful AI assistants. Tools like Google’s Gemini CLI, GitHub Copilot CLI, and Anthropic’s Claude Code CLI are transforming how developers interact with their code, debug issues, and automate tasks directly from the terminal.

    But with these formidable options, which one is the right fit for your workflow? Let’s dive deep into a comparison of these three AI terminal titans.

    Understanding the Core Concept

    Before we compare, it’s crucial to understand what these tools aim to achieve: They are designed to:

    • Generate Code: Write new code snippets, functions, or even entire files based on natural language prompts.
    • Debug & Explain: Help identify errors, suggest fixes, and explain complex code sections.
    • Automate Tasks: Create shell commands, Git commands, or even full scripts to automate repetitive actions.
    • Answer Questions: Provide instant answers to programming queries or conceptual questions.
    • Interact with Your Environment: Often, they can read from and write to your local files and interact with your terminal’s output.

    Now, let’s stack them up.

    1. Gemini CLI (Google)

    The AI Powerhouse in Your Terminal

    Google’s Gemini CLI brings the raw power of the Gemini large language models directly to your command line. As part of Google’s AI ecosystem, it’s designed for seamless integration for developers working with Google Cloud services and beyond.

    Key Features & Strengths:

    • Gemini Model Integration: Leverages the latest Gemini models, known for their strong reasoning capabilities, multi-modality (though primarily text-based in CLI), and broad knowledge base. This means robust code generation, detailed explanations, and accurate answers.
    • Versatility: Capable of generating code in various languages, explaining complex concepts, and even formulating complex shell commands.
    • Contextual Understanding: Can understand the broader context of your prompts, leading to more relevant and useful suggestions.
    • Google Ecosystem Synergy: Potentially offers deeper integration with Google Cloud services, APIs, and frameworks for developers already entrenched in that environment.

    Considerations:

    • Availability: While widely accessible, its full feature set and model versions might be tied to specific regions or Google Cloud access.

    Best For: Developers deeply invested in the Google ecosystem, those who need cutting-edge model performance, and users who appreciate the versatility of a general-purpose AI assistant in their terminal.

    2. GitHub Copilot CLI (Microsoft/GitHub)

    Your Personal Shell Assistant

    GitHub Copilot revolutionized IDE-based code completion, and its CLI counterpart extends that intelligence to your shell. Primarily focused on streamlining shell commands and Git operations, it’s a powerful ally for everyday developer tasks.

    Key Features & Strengths:

    • Shell Command Generation: Its standout feature is generating complex shell commands (like grep, awk, find, sed, ffmpeg, etc.) from natural language. This is incredibly useful for developers who struggle to remember obscure command syntax.
    • Git Integration: Can help construct intricate Git commands, understand your repository status, and even assist with commit messages.
    • Explain & Suggest: Offers explanations for existing commands and suggests the “next logical command” based on your previous actions.
    • ?? and git? Syntax: Intuitive and quick to use, simply prefix your natural language query with ?? for general shell commands or git? for Git-specific queries.
    • Integration with GitHub Ecosystem: Naturally fits into the workflow of developers who heavily use GitHub for version control.

    Considerations:

    • Subscription Model: Requires a GitHub Copilot subscription, which might be an additional cost for some users.
    • Focus: While it can answer coding questions, its primary strength lies in shell and Git command assistance, making it less of a general-purpose code generator compared to Gemini or Claude for large code blocks.

    Best For: Developers who spend a lot of time in the terminal, frequently use complex shell commands, and want to boost their Git productivity. If you’re already a Copilot subscriber, this is a natural extension.

    3. Claude Code CLI (Anthropic)

    The Secure and Context-Aware Collaborator

    Anthropic’s Claude Code CLI is a strong contender, emphasizing its advanced reasoning capabilities and its focus on secure, responsible AI. It’s designed to act as a sophisticated “terminal agent” that can not only generate but also intelligently interact with and modify your codebase.

    Key Features & Strengths:

    • Contextual Reasoning: Claude models are known for their ability to handle large contexts and perform complex reasoning tasks, which translates to intelligent code suggestions, detailed explanations, and effective debugging assistance.
    • File Modification & Task Execution: A key differentiator is its ability to modify files directly, fix errors, and execute test commands based on your instructions. This moves beyond just suggesting code to actively assisting in development tasks.
    • GitHub Actions Integration: Can integrate with GitHub Actions for automated PR management and code reviews, hinting at a more autonomous and proactive role.
    • Privacy and Security Focus: Anthropic places a strong emphasis on constitutional AI and responsible development, which can be a significant factor for enterprise users.
    • OpenTelemetry Support: Provides monitoring capabilities, which is valuable for tracking agent performance and usage.

    Considerations:

    • Closed-Source Tool: Unlike some other options, Claude Code CLI is a closed-source tool, meaning less transparency into its inner workings.
    • Availability/Access: Access might be more controlled or feature sets tied to specific enterprise agreements initially.

    Best For: Teams and developers who require a highly capable AI agent that can actively assist with code modifications and automated workflows, with a strong emphasis on robust reasoning and responsible AI practices.

    Head-to-Head Comparison

    Feature/Aspect Gemini CLI GitHub Copilot CLI Claude Code CLI
    Primary Strength General-purpose AI, Code Generation Shell & Git Command Automation Contextual Reasoning, Active File Modification
    Underlying Model Gemini LLMs OpenAI GPT Models (via Copilot) Anthropic’s Claude LLMs
    Core Interaction Direct natural language prompts ?? for shell, git? for Git, direct prompts Natural language instructions, task-oriented
    File Modification Primarily suggests, can integrate with scripts Suggests commands for file interaction Can directly modify files, fix errors, run tests
    Shell Commands Can generate complex commands Excellent at generating shell/Git commands Can generate commands, but also act on results
    Debugging Strong explanation and suggestion Can explain commands/errors Highly capable, can suggest and implement fixes
    Ecosystem Fit Google Cloud, general dev GitHub, Git workflows Enterprise, secure AI workflows
    Pricing Free to use GitHub Copilot subscription API usage-based (Anthropic)

    Conclusion: Choosing Your Terminal Companion

    The “best” CLI tool depends entirely on your needs:

    • If you need a robust, general-purpose AI assistant that can generate complex code, answer broad questions, and help you understand new concepts, Gemini CLI is an excellent choice. Its powerful underlying models make it incredibly versatile, and the fact that it’s free to use is a significant advantage.
    • If your daily pain points revolve around remembering arcane shell commands, crafting complex Git operations, and boosting your command-line efficiency, GitHub Copilot CLI will be your best friend. It excels at making you a shell wizard.
    • If you’re looking for an intelligent agent that can not only suggest but also actively participate in modifying your code, fix bugs, and integrate with automated pipelines, Claude Code CLI offers a compelling vision of the future of AI-assisted development. Its strong reasoning and action capabilities set it apart.

    The rise of these AI-powered CLI tools marks a significant shift in developer productivity. They aren’t just fancy auto-completers; they are intelligent collaborators that reside directly where much of our work happens. Experiment with them, understand their strengths, and integrate them into your workflow. The future of coding is conversational, and it’s happening right in your terminal.

  • Gemini CLI: Power Up Your Terminal with AI

    Gemini CLI: Power Up Your Terminal with AI

    In a move that’s set to revolutionize the way developers work, Google has introduced Gemini CLI, a free and open-source AI agent that brings the power of Gemini directly into your command-line interface. This powerful tool is designed to streamline your workflow, boost your productivity, and change the way you interact with your code.

    This blog post will serve as your ultimate guide to Gemini CLI, covering its features, installation, and pricing.

    Key Features of Gemini CLI

    Gemini CLI is more than just a coding assistant; it’s a versatile tool that can handle a wide range of tasks. Here are some of its standout features:

    • Open Source and Free: Gemini CLI is fully open-source under the Apache 2.0 license. This means you can inspect the code, contribute to its development, and use it for free with a personal Google account.
    • Generous Free Tier: Individual developers get an impressive allowance of 1,000 requests per day and 60 requests per minute, all powered by the Gemini 2.5 Pro model with a massive 1 million token context window.
    • Seamless Integration: Gemini CLI integrates directly into your terminal, eliminating the need to switch between different applications. It works on all major platforms: macOS, Windows, and Linux.
    • Code Understanding and Analysis: It can analyze complex codebases, explain legacy code, suggest modernizations, identify security vulnerabilities, and even generate documentation.
    • File and Project Management: Organize your files, restructure projects while maintaining dependencies, and perform bulk file operations using natural language commands.
    • Advanced Integration Capabilities: Gemini CLI has built-in support for the Model Context Protocol (MCP), allowing for extensibility. It also leverages Google Search to provide real-time references and documentation.
    • Multimedia Integration: It works with tools like Imagen and Veo to assist with creative content generation.

    How to Install Gemini CLI

    Getting started with Gemini CLI is incredibly simple. Here’s how you can install it:

    1. Prerequisites: Make sure you have Node.js version 18 or higher installed on your system.
    2. Run the CLI: Open your terminal and execute the following command:
    npx [https://github.com/google-gemini/gemini-cli](https://github.com/google-gemini/gemini-cli)
    

    Alternatively, you can install it globally using npm:

    npm install -g @google/gemini-cli
    
    1. Authentication: You’ll be prompted to sign in with your personal Google account. This will grant you access to the generous free tier.

    That’s it! You’re now ready to start using Gemini CLI.

    Gemini CLI Pricing

    Gemini_CLI

    For individual developers, Gemini CLI is free to use. The free tier, which comes with a Gemini Code Assist license, provides access to Gemini 2.5 Pro and the high usage limits mentioned earlier.

    For professional developers and enterprises that require even more power, there are paid plans available:

    • Gemini Code Assist Standard: This plan is priced at $19 per user per month with an annual commitment or $22.80 per user per month with a monthly commitment.
    • Gemini Code Assist Enterprise: This plan costs $45 per user per month with a yearly commitment or $54 per user per month with a monthly commitment.

    These paid plans offer additional features and higher usage limits, making them suitable for teams and organizations with more demanding needs. You can also use your own paid API key from Google AI Studio or Vertex AI for usage-based billing.
